gir489 Posted October 16, 2019 Share Posted October 16, 2019 Why can't I associate the Paint.NET windows store app with PNG or JPG files? Before I could just set it to C:\Program Files\Paint.NET\PaintDotNet.exe, but now it won't let me because it's in C:\Program Files\WindowsApps\ . Rick Brewster Posted October 24, 2019 Share Posted October 24, 2019 The Store app should already be associated with PNG and JPG files. If you need to edit file type associations, use "Default apps" in System Settings.
